Udyam MSME Registration is an Indian government platform that is designed to encourage and support small businesses. MSME is an acronym for Micro, Small, and Medium Enterprises. These companies are very critical for a country as they provide employment opportunities, support local markets, and bring up the economy.
Previously, the system of MSME registration was quite complex and confusing. To address this, the Indian government has launched Udyam Registration. It is an online, simple, and paperless procedure. Udyam Registration registers small & medium enterprises (SME) in a centralized system of the Ministry of MSME and enables an easy interface to Govt. / Banks/Financers / Laws / Regulatory process, etc., for the small business owners to communicate and to transact with them. The main aim of Udyam Registration is to ease the lives of Small Business Owners and Grow Them Safely and legally.”

Legal Identity for Small Business
Many small businesses operate in the shadows without any formal registration. They don’t get treated as formal enterprises either. One of the key goals of Udyam Registration is to provide these Enterprises a legal identity. On successful registration, a company is assigned a Udyam Registration Number and a certificate. This demonstrates that the MSME is registered with the Government of India. This legal identity also helps in gaining trust with banks, customers, and government departments.”
Simplifying Access to Government Benefits
The government offers numerous incentives to MSMEs, including subsidies, assistance with loans, and training schemes. But businesses are not entitled to those benefits unless they register.
Udyam Registration facilitates the MSMEs to make use of the Government Schemes. Once registered, the business is entitled to a number of facilities, including:
- Loan subsidies
- Financial support
- Marketing assistance
- Skill and training programmes
The main objective here is to ensure that real small businesses get proper government support.
Simple and stress-free registration Process
Earlier registration of MSME required paperwork, filling of various forms, and visiting offices. This was tough on small business owners.
Simplicity is one of the prime concerns of Udyam registration. The process is entirely online, free of charge, and through self-declaration. Just Aadhaar, PAN, and business details are needed.
This saves time and reduces stress for entrepreneurs.
Helping Businesses Get Bank Loans Easily
Small businesses frequently have difficulty obtaining loans from the banks. Banks are more comfortable lending to registered firms.
Udyam Registration enables MSMEs to get easier banking access. MSMEs that are registered can avail of:
- Lower interest rates
- Priority sector lending
- Loans without security through government schemes
The aim is to increase the availability of finance to small businesses.
Protection Against Late Payments
Delay in payment is a major issue for MSMEs. Small businesses struggle with cash flow when customers hold payments.
Protection against delayed payments is provided by Udyam Registration. Registered MSMEs can also lodge complaints if buyers default on payments. This allows businesses to receive their payments earlier and remain financially healthy.
Supporting New Entrepreneurs and Startups
When you’re starting a business, it can be intimidating, particularly if it’s your first time. Being dissuaded from business formation by complex rules is not unheard of.
Udyam Registration is simple and free of cost. This will motivate the fresh entrepreneurs, startups, women entrepreneurs, and young business owners to get their business registered and grow with confidence.
Creating More Jobs
MSMEs are the largest job creators in India. When small-business owners expand, they hire more people.
The aim of Udyam Registration is to empower the MSMEs in a way that they grow and provide more job opportunities. This leads to reducing the rate of unemployment and raising the living standards.
Supporting Exports and Market Growth
A large number of MSMEs also sell products outside India. Udyam Registration allows such entrepreneurs to avail export-related benefits and support of the government.
This goal supports MSMEs to grow in the national and international markets.
Supporting Rural and Small Town Businesses
In fact, many of the MSMEs are based in villages and smaller towns. Udyam Registration brings these businesses under the ambit of the formal system.
This promotes rural growth and curbs rural-to-urban migration for employment.
